Linear function
A linear function is defined in slope-intercept formula by the rule presented as follows:
y = mx + b.
In which:
m is the constant rate of change of the function, called slope.
b is the value of y when x = 0, called intercept.
For Sidewalk 1, it is found that:
When x increases by 2, y increases by 4, hence the slope is of m = 2.
When x = 0, y = 3, hence the intercept is of b = 3.
Then the rule is:
y = 2x + 3.
For Sidewalk 2, when x changes by 2, y decays by 2, hence the slope is:
m = -2/2 = -1.
The line goes through point (1,5), hence the equation in point-slope form is:
y - 5 = -(x - 1).
Combining the like terms, the slope-intercept form is:
y - 5 = -x + 1
y = -x + 6.
Since the two lines have different slopes, the system is consistent independent.
The x-coordinate of the intersection is:
-x + 6 = 3 + 2x.
3x = 3
x = 1.
The y-coordinate is:
-x + 6 = -1 + 6 = 5.
Hence the intersection point is:
(1, 5).

Roni starts with the number 5 and counts by 8s. This results in the sequence 5, 13, 21, 29, 37, and so on. What is the twenty-fifth number in the sequence
The 25th number in the arithmetic sequence is 197.
The sequence starts with the number 5 and counts by 8s. To find the 25th number in the sequence, we need to find the number that comes after the 24th number.
To do this, we can use the formula for the nth term of an arithmetic sequence, which is given by the formula:
aₙ = a₁ + (n - 1)d
In this case, a₁ is the first term of the sequence (5), n is the number of terms (25), and d is the common difference (8). Plugging these values into the formula, we get:
a₂₅ = 5 + (25 - 1) * 8
Simplifying this expression, we get:
a₂₅ = 5 + 24 * 8
= 5 + 192
= 197
Therefore, the 25th number in the sequence is 197.

A deficiency in the release of vasopressin (antidiuretic hormone [ADH]) by the posterior pituitary gland causes: a. hypoglycemia. b. dwarfism. c. diabetes insipidus. d. none of the above.
A deficiency in the release of vasopressin (ADH) by the posterior pituitary gland causes diabetes insipidus. Option C
Diabetes insipidus is a condition characterized by the inability of the body to regulate water balance due to a deficiency in the release of vasopressin, also known as antidiuretic hormone (ADH), by the posterior pituitary gland. Vasopressin plays a crucial role in regulating water reabsorption in the kidneys, thereby controlling urine concentration and volume.
When there is a deficiency of vasopressin, the kidneys are unable to properly reabsorb water, leading to excessive urination and increased thirst. This condition is called diabetes insipidus, which is different from diabetes mellitus, a condition related to blood sugar regulation.
Hypoglycemia refers to low blood sugar levels and is not directly associated with a deficiency in vasopressin. Dwarfism, on the other hand, is a condition characterized by stunted growth and is caused by various factors such as genetic mutations or hormonal imbalances, but not specifically by a deficiency in vasopressin.

1. there are 18 mathematics majors and 325 computer science majors at a college. a) in how many ways can two representatives be picked so that one is a mathematics major and the other is a computer science major? b) in how many ways can one representative be picked who is either a
a) two representatives be picked in 5850 ways so that one is a mathematics major and the other is a computer science major. b) one representative be picked in 343 ways who is either a mathematics major or a computer science major.
Product Rule: If one event occurs in m ways and a second event occurs in n ways, the number of ways the two events occur in the sequence is m×n ways.
Sum Rule: If an event occurs either in m ways or in n ways (non-overlapping), the number of ways the event can occur is m+n ways.
according to the question,
Mathematics majors =18 and Computer science majors = 325
A. We need to use the product rule because the first event is picking up a Mathematics major and the second event is picking up a computer science major.
= 18 x 325
= 5850
B. Here sum rule is applicable because the event is picking up a mathematics major or a computer science major.
= 18 + 325
= 343
